The story of Mattie Thompson began in 1895 in Arkansas. In 1900, Mattie Thompson resided in White River, Izard, Arkansas, USA. In 1920, Mattie Thompson resided in Joplin, Jasper, Missouri, USA. Mattie Thompson married Bee Thompson, and had children including James Leonard Thompson, Ruby Bernice Thompson, Willa Mae Thompson. Mattie Thompson passed away in 1943 in Joplin, Newton County, Missouri, United States of America.
